I was in the same situation and bought the Epson p600. However, for the foreseeable future I'm keeping OEM color inks in it. I need a color printer. That said, I assume the dedicated B&W inks that are available would work fine in it -- with some caveats. You might need to linearize profiles yourself. Also, I do not know about the quality of empty, refillable carts.

However, my old Epson SP 1400 died this week, so I need a new printer for my Eboni inks and I need your help folks... Which one should I choose? I had a quick look to Epson product line, and considering the fact that I'm on Ebony, and that I' might move to Piezo HD one day, I saw 2 potential candidates: SC-P400 and SC-P600. P600 is listed by QTR, not P400.

> Can P400 be used by QTR anyway?

> Is the P400 a good choice? Or is there any good reason to go to P600 (more expensive, of course)?
